View PDFMD-31D Request-to-Exit PIR Sensor
The SDC MD31D Passive Infrared Detector is specifically designed for request-to-exit applications. The coverage field is internally pointable. When angled 14° down, coverage may be 5 x 6 feet at 7 feet high to 10 x 12 feet at 15 feet high. The MD31D projects a wrap around "U" pattern down and away from the door to inhibit tampering.
The MD31D complies with national fire and building code requirements for Access Controlled Egress Doors listed below:
- IBC International Code 1008.1.3.4
- IFC International Fire Code 1008.1.3.4
- NFPA 101 Life Safety Code 7.2.1.6.2
- NFPA 1.15.5.3.2
- BOCA National Building Code 1017.4.5
- SBCCI Standard Building Code 1012.7
- Adjustable 1-60 Second Time Delay
- May be Mounted to Frame Header, Wall or Ceiling
- Complies with NFPA Applications

SPECIFICATIONS
| Input | 12 or 24 VDC/VAC @ 26mA max. |
|---|---|
| Contact | 2 SPDT Dry, 1 Amp @ 30VDC |
| Operating Temperature | 14°F to 122°F (-10°C to 50°C) |
| Dimensions | 2"H x 7"W x 2"D |
CODE COMPLIANT EGRESS SENSOR
PIR egress sensor with failsafe mode (lock releases when power to PIR sensor is interrupted).
